> It does have an angle drive, which may merely need tightening. Also, the
> cable may be loose behind the Speedo=E2=80=94a bit easier to check. I=E2=
=80=99d begin by
> unscrewing it from behind=E2=80=94yes you have to squeeze yourself under =
the
> dash=E2=80=94and letting it hang down where you can see it from the drive=
rs seat.
> Then take a slow drive down your driveway to see whether the cable is
> turning inside the sheath. If so, you know the angle drive is fine. Next
> reinsert the end carefully into the back of the Speedo, being sure the
> square end inserts fully and the knurled  nut tightens (by hand) all the
> way home. Turn the inner cable with your fingers if needed to line it up.
> Then take a brief drive; if the Speedo works, the cable was loose at back=
.
> If not, the gauge needs service.
